National Theatre Live: King Lear

National Theatre Live: King Lear 2018

Directed by Jonathan Munby

No ratings yet
227 min
Drama

Considered by many to be the greatest tragedy ever written, King Lear sees two ageing fathers – one a King, one his courtier – reject the children who truly love them. Their blindness unleashes a tornado of pitiless ambition and treachery, as family and state are plunged into a violent power struggle with bitter ends.
